Is Android browser supports Content-Encoding : gzip ?

(網址)

HI all

I am developing a application which launches automatically when the
user clicks on any link of pls / m3u in browser it works fine.

But some links the response from server is like bellow it dos't
launches my activity

i founded that the difference is only Content-Encoding: gzip is extra
in those not working links

The android browser also dos't support these links

url : http://dir.xiph.org/by_format/MP3

HTTP/1.1 200 OK
Date: Tue, 24 Mar 2009 06:22:48 GMT
Server: Apache/2.2.4 (Ubuntu) PHP/5.2.3-1ubuntu6.3
X-Powered-By: PHP/5.2.3-1ubuntu6.3
Content-Disposition: inline; filename="listen.m3u"
Content-Encoding: gzip
Vary: Accept-Encoding
Content-Length: 82
Connection: close
Content-Type: audio/x-mpegurl

How can i specify the Content-Encoding in intent filter

is Android browser supports Content-Encoding : gzip


Answer : No ~~~~
